Understanding Flash Loan Arbitrage

Flash loan arbitrage is a trading strategy that leverages the impermanent nature of DeFi lending protocols. Essentially, a flash loan allows you to borrow an amount of cryptocurrency without collateral, provided you repay the loan within a single transaction. The primary goal of flash loan arbitrage is to exploit price differences across various decentralized exchanges (DEXs) to make a profit.

To grasp the concept fully, imagine a situation where the price of a token differs on two different exchanges. By borrowing the token from one exchange and immediately selling it on another where it's priced higher, you can pocket the difference. The trick, of course, lies in executing this within the constraints of a flash loan, which means you must repay the borrowed amount plus any fees within the same transaction.

The Mechanics Behind Flash Loans

Flash loans operate under a few key principles that are crucial to understanding how they can be used for arbitrage:

No Collateral Required: Unlike traditional loans, flash loans do not require any collateral. This means that theoretically, you can borrow any amount and risk only the fees associated with the transaction.

Single Transaction Constraint: The loan must be repaid in the same transaction it is borrowed. This constraint makes the strategy fast and potentially profitable, but it also demands precise execution.

Interest-Free: Flash loans do not accrue interest, which can be a significant advantage in volatile markets.

Key Strategies for Safe Flash Loan Arbitrage

To engage in flash loan arbitrage safely, it's vital to understand and implement several key strategies:

Market Analysis: Before you start, thoroughly analyze the market. Identify tokens with significant price discrepancies across different exchanges. Tools like price oracles and arbitrage scanners can help you find these opportunities.

Liquidity Pools: Ensure that the exchanges you target have enough liquidity to execute your trades without moving the price significantly. Low liquidity can lead to slippage, which can eat into your profits or cause losses.

Gas Fees: DeFi transactions require gas fees, which can sometimes be substantial. Always consider these fees when planning your arbitrage strategy to ensure that your potential profit covers the costs.

Smart Contract Audits: Use only well-audited smart contracts for executing flash loans. This minimizes the risk of bugs or vulnerabilities that could lead to losses.

Test Strategies: Before committing real funds, test your strategies on testnets. This allows you to refine your approach without financial risk.

Risks and Precautions

While flash loan arbitrage can be lucrative, it is fraught with risks. Here’s how to mitigate them:

Volatility: Cryptocurrency markets are notoriously volatile. Even small price changes can significantly impact your profits. Use stop-loss orders to protect against unexpected market shifts.

Smart Contract Risks: Bugs in smart contracts can lead to unexpected behavior. Always rely on contracts that have been audited by reputable firms.

Network Congestion: Gas fees can spike during times of high network congestion. Plan your trades during off-peak times to keep costs manageable.

Liquidity Risk: Always ensure there is enough liquidity to execute your trades. Attempting to trade on thinly traded pairs can lead to significant price slippage.

Real-World Case Studies

To better understand how flash loan arbitrage works in practice, let’s look at a couple of real-world examples:

Example 1: Uniswap Arbitrage

Imagine a scenario where ETH/USDT is priced at $1,500 on Uniswap but $1,510 on another DEX. To execute an arbitrage trade:

Borrow 1 ETH using a flash loan on Uniswap. Immediately sell the ETH on the other DEX for $1,510. Repay the flash loan and pocket the $10 profit minus gas fees. Example 2: Cross-Chain Arbitrage

Suppose you notice that DAI is priced at $1 on Ethereum but $1.02 on Binance Smart Chain (BSC). To execute a cross-chain arbitrage:

Borrow DAI using a flash loan on Ethereum. Use a bridge to transfer DAI to BSC. Sell the DAI on BSC for a $0.02 profit. Repay the flash loan and withdraw your profits back to Ethereum.

One of the most immediate and accessible avenues for profiting from Web3 is through cryptocurrencies. While often associated with speculative trading, cryptocurrencies are the native currency of the decentralized web. Beyond Bitcoin and Ethereum, thousands of altcoins serve various functions within their respective ecosystems. Profiting can occur through several means:

Trading and Investing: This involves buying cryptocurrencies when their value is low and selling when it rises. This requires a keen understanding of market dynamics, technological developments, and macroeconomic factors. Diversification across different projects and risk management strategies are crucial. The volatility inherent in the crypto market presents both significant opportunities and substantial risks. It’s about identifying promising projects with strong fundamentals, innovative use cases, and active development teams.

Staking and Yield Farming: Decentralized Finance (DeFi) protocols allow users to earn passive income by locking up their cryptocurrencies in various liquidity pools or for network validation. Staking involves contributing your crypto to a Proof-of-Stake blockchain to help secure the network and earn rewards in return. Yield farming is more complex, involving providing liquidity to decentralized exchanges (DEXs) or lending protocols to earn transaction fees and governance tokens. These methods offer potentially higher returns than traditional savings accounts but come with their own set of risks, including smart contract vulnerabilities and impermanent loss.

Mining: While the profitability of Bitcoin mining has become increasingly specialized and capital-intensive, other Proof-of-Work blockchains still offer opportunities for miners. This involves using computing power to validate transactions and secure the network, earning newly minted coins as a reward. It requires significant investment in hardware and electricity, making it less accessible to the average individual.

Beyond currencies, Non-Fungible Tokens (NFTs) have exploded into public consciousness, transforming digital ownership. NFTs are unique digital assets stored on a blockchain, representing ownership of anything from digital art and collectibles to in-game items and virtual real estate. Profiting from NFTs can take several forms:

Creation and Sales: Artists, musicians, and content creators can mint their work as NFTs and sell them directly to a global audience on marketplaces like OpenSea, Rarible, and Foundation. This disintermediates traditional art dealers and publishers, allowing creators to retain a larger share of the revenue and even earn royalties on secondary sales.

Trading and Flipping: Similar to trading cryptocurrencies, NFTs can be bought with the expectation of selling them at a higher price. This requires a discerning eye for emerging trends, popular artists, and projects with strong community backing. Understanding rarity, utility, and historical sales data is key to successful NFT flipping.

NFT-Based Gaming (Play-to-Earn): The gaming industry is being revolutionized by Web3. Play-to-earn (P2E) games allow players to earn cryptocurrency and NFTs through gameplay, which can then be traded for real-world value. Games like Axie Infinity pioneered this model, where players breed, battle, and trade digital creatures (Axies) to earn rewards. Profiting here involves skill, strategy, and often an initial investment in game assets.

Royalties: Many NFT platforms allow creators to program royalties into their smart contracts. This means that every time an NFT is resold on the secondary market, the original creator automatically receives a percentage of the sale price. This provides a continuous revenue stream and aligns creator incentives with the long-term value of their work.

The concept of Decentralized Autonomous Organizations (DAOs) represents a significant shift in governance and collective ownership. DAOs are organizations run by code and governed by their members, typically token holders. They offer unique avenues for profiting through participation and contribution:

Governance Token Ownership: Holding DAO governance tokens often grants voting rights on proposals that shape the future of the project. This can also lead to financial gains if the DAO's success drives up the value of its token. Some DAOs also distribute a portion of their generated revenue to token holders.

Contributing to DAOs: DAOs often need skilled individuals to contribute to development, marketing, community management, and other operational aspects. These contributions are frequently compensated with the DAO's native tokens, offering a way to earn income while actively participating in a decentralized project's growth.

The Metaverse, a persistent, interconnected set of virtual spaces where users can interact with each other, digital objects, and AI avatars, is another fertile ground for Web3 profit. As these virtual worlds become more sophisticated and populated, so too do the economic opportunities:

Virtual Real Estate: Owning and developing virtual land in metaverses like Decentraland or The Sandbox can be profitable. This involves buying plots of land and then developing them into shops, galleries, event spaces, or even games, which can then be rented out or sold for a profit. The value of virtual real estate is driven by its location, utility, and the overall demand for space within a particular metaverse.

Creating and Selling Digital Assets: From avatar clothing and accessories to virtual furniture and art installations, creators can design and sell digital assets within the metaverse. These assets are often sold as NFTs, ensuring ownership and scarcity.

Hosting Events and Experiences: As metaverses mature, the demand for engaging content and events will grow. Individuals and businesses can profit by hosting virtual concerts, art exhibitions, conferences, and other experiences that attract users and generate revenue through ticket sales or sponsorships.

Play-to-Earn in the Metaverse: Similar to standalone P2E games, metaverse experiences can incorporate earning mechanics, allowing users to be rewarded with cryptocurrency or NFTs for their time, effort, and engagement within these virtual worlds.

One of the most profound shifts Web3 is bringing is to finance. Decentralized Finance (DeFi) is not just about earning passive income on your crypto holdings; it’s about reimagining the entire financial system, making it more accessible, transparent, and efficient. Profiting from DeFi involves understanding its various protocols and participating strategically:

Lending and Borrowing: DeFi protocols allow users to lend their crypto assets to earn interest or borrow assets by providing collateral. Platforms like Aave and Compound have created robust markets where individuals can earn significant yields on their deposited assets, often much higher than traditional banking offers. Conversely, borrowing can be strategic for those who need liquidity without selling their assets.

Liquidity Provision: As mentioned earlier, providing liquidity to decentralized exchanges (DEXs) is a cornerstone of DeFi. By depositing pairs of tokens into a liquidity pool, users earn a share of the trading fees generated on that pair. This is a critical function that keeps DEXs running, and liquidity providers are rewarded for facilitating these trades. The risk here is impermanent loss, where the value of your deposited assets might decrease compared to simply holding them, due to price fluctuations.

Decentralized Exchanges (DEXs): Beyond providing liquidity, actively participating in DEX governance through token ownership can yield returns. Furthermore, identifying and trading on emerging DEXs that offer innovative features or unique token listings can be a profitable strategy, akin to spotting emerging stock markets before they become mainstream.

Insurance Protocols: With the rise of DeFi, smart contract risks and other potential vulnerabilities have also emerged. Decentralized insurance protocols are developing to mitigate these risks. Investing in or even contributing to these insurance protocols can offer returns as they mature and cover a growing portion of the DeFi ecosystem.

The revolution in digital content and media is another significant area where Web3 is unlocking profit potential. By empowering creators and fostering direct engagement with audiences, Web3 is challenging the established intermediaries:

Decentralized Social Networks: Platforms like Lens Protocol and Farcaster are building social graphs that are owned by the users. Creators can earn through direct tipping, token-gated content, and by building their own communities without censorship or algorithmic manipulation that prioritizes advertiser interests. Profiting here means building a following, creating engaging content, and leveraging the unique monetization tools these decentralized platforms offer.

Token-Gated Content and Communities: NFTs and fungible tokens can act as keys to exclusive content, communities, or experiences. Creators can sell these tokens to grant access, creating a direct revenue stream and fostering a loyal, engaged audience. This allows for tiered membership models and a more personalized relationship between creators and their fans.

Decentralized Publishing and Media: Projects are emerging that allow for the decentralized storage and distribution of content, cutting out traditional publishers and ad networks. Creators can earn through micropayments, token rewards, or by selling access to their work directly. This fosters a more equitable distribution of value, where creators are better compensated for their efforts.
